GridGenericMetric::metric_t 
ETXMetric::get_link_metric(const EtherAddress &e, bool) const
{
  // ETX ix currently symmetric: it is the same in both directions, so
  // we ignore the bool parameter.  This would change if the ETX
  // computation tried to correct for ACK sizes.

  unsigned tau_fwd, tau_rev;
  unsigned r_fwd, r_rev;
  struct timeval t_fwd;

  bool res_fwd = _ls->get_forward_rate(e, &r_fwd, &tau_fwd, &t_fwd);
  bool res_rev = _ls->get_reverse_rate(e, &r_rev, &tau_rev);

  if (!res_fwd || !res_rev)
    return _bad_metric;
  if (r_fwd == 0 || r_rev == 0)
    return _bad_metric;

  if (r_fwd > 100)
    r_fwd = 100;
  if (r_rev > 100)
    r_rev = 100;

  unsigned val = (100 * 100 * 100) / (r_fwd * r_rev);
  assert(val >= 100);

  return metric_t(val);      
}

GridGenericMetric::metric_t
ETXMetric::append_metric(const metric_t &r, const metric_t &l) const
{
  if (!r.good() || !l.good())
    return _bad_metric;
  
  if (r.val() < 100)
    click_chatter("ETXMetric %s: append_metric WARNING: metric %u%% transmissions is too low for route metric",
		  name().c_str(), r.val());
  if (l.val() < 100)
    click_chatter("ETXMetric %s: append_metric WARNING: metric %u%% transmissions is too low for link metric",
		  name().c_str(), r.val());

  return metric_t(r.val() + l.val());
}
